Responsibilities

  • Coordinate patient admissions and discharge procedures during overnight hours
  • Manage electronic health records with precision and HIPAA compliance
  • Facilitate communication between night staff, on-call physicians, and emergency services
  • Monitor patient vitals and respond to urgent care requests promptly
  • Administer basic medical procedures under physician supervision
  • Maintain sterile environments and inventory of medical supplies
  • Document care activities in real-time using EMR systems

Qualifications

  • Current California CNA or Medical Assistant certification required
  • Minimum 1 year experience in healthcare or clinical setting
  • Proficiency with EMR systems (Epic experience preferred)
  • Valid BLS/CPR certification
  • Exceptional communication skills during high-pressure situations
  • Ability to stand/walk for 8+ hours and lift 25 lbs
  • Strong attention to detail in documentation and patient care
  • Availability to work 3-4 overnight shifts weekly (10 PM - 6 AM)
